    Battle Scars Podcast with Tim Klund and Rocci Stucci welcome Bailey Groves and Chelsea Matlock to the show. Both women were born and raised in North Texas and graduated from Tarleton State University,

    where they pursued their passions and gained a wealth of knowledge that would later serve them well as entrepreneurs.

    Chelsea received her Bachelor's degree in Animal Production and her Master's in Animal Science with an emphasis in Equine Reproduction. Meanwhile, Bailey earned her Bachelor's degree in Business Administration with an emphasis in Marketing. Together, they co-own multiple businesses, including a successful real estate business that closes more than $30 million each year.

    But their dynamic doesn't stop there. When they're not selling real estate, you can find them working on investment properties or riding horses. From an early age, Bailey and Chelsea never quite fit the mold of what society expected from them. However, they continued to challenge the status quo and create their unique path in life.

    Cheaters, one of Habeeb's most popular shows, is a guilty pleasure for millions of viewers. The show follows private investigators as they catch cheaters in the act, exposing their infidelity to their partners. With hidden cameras, dramatic confrontations, and explosive reactions, Cheaters is a rollercoaster ride of emotions that will keep you on the edge of your seat.     Kenny "The Shark" Gant made a name for himself in the NFL during the 1990s. He was known for his hard-hitting style of play, as well as his iconic "Shark Dance" celebration. Gant's legacy in football is one that will forever be remembered by fans, players, and coaches alike.     The D.O.C., is an American rapper, songwriter, and record producer. In addition to a solo career, he was a member of the Southern hip hop group Fila Fresh Crew and later collaborated with group N.W.A–where he co-wrote many of their releases–as well as Eazy-E's solo debut album Eazy-Duz-It. He has also worked with Dr. Dre, co-writing his solo debut album, while Dre produced Curry's solo debut album, released by Ruthless Records.

    He was also one of the founders of Death Row Records.
    After Fila Fresh Crew split up in 1988, the D.O.C. went on to pursue a successful solo career. In 1989, he released his debut album, No One Can Do It Better, which reached number-one on the US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ums chart for two weeks and spawned two number one hits on the Hot Rap Songs chart: "It's Funky Enough" and "The D.O.C. & The Doctor". The album went platinum five years after its release. In late 1989, months after the release of No One Can Do It Better, the D.O.C. suffered a serious car crash that permanently changed his voice. Since his accident, he has released two more albums, Helter Skelter in 1996 and Deuce in 2003. In 2015, he said his voice was fully recovered.

    For most it’s an iconic moment captured in a timeless photo and placed in just about every U.S. history book in existence: that moment a group of United States Marines planted the American Flag on the peak of Iwo Jima during World War II.

    It’s an image of patriotism for most, but for Don Graves it’s a memory that still lives as clearly in his mind as it did the day after he stood just feet away from that flag being planted in the rocks.

    “That was my Colonel’s flag,” said Graves who was 19 when he and his unit fought in that infamous battle. “He gave it to Lt. Schrier and said, ‘put this up Harold. Get some boys together, and put it up for me.’”


    Graves, who’s now in his 90’s, said gunfire was raining down on him and his fellow marines as they took in the sight of that flag being planted on the Japanese island; a battle that ended up being a major step in victory during the war.
